Casual Frontshop Assistant Opportunity at Dis-Chem Pharmacies Fields Hill Kloof

The Casual Frontshop Assistant position at Dis-Chem Fields Hill Kloof is an entry-level retail opportunity within one of South Africa’s leading pharmacy groups. This role supports both customer service and merchandising in a newly opened store environment. It is designed for individuals who want to gain experience in retail operations, stock handling, and point-of-sale systems. The position is part-time and suits candidates who are flexible and willing to work retail hours. It offers exposure to FMCG retail, customer interaction, and structured store procedures.
What the Frontshop Assistant Role Involves
This role focuses on maintaining store standards while supporting customers at the point of sale. You will work on the shop floor, assisting with product availability, pricing accuracy, and general store presentation. A large part of the job involves ensuring shelves are fully stocked and properly organised. You also help customers with product queries and ensure a smooth shopping experience. The role requires consistency, attention to detail, and a customer-first mindset.
Core responsibilities include:
- Restocking shelves and maintaining product availability
- Ensuring products are correctly labelled and priced
- Monitoring expiry dates and removing outdated stock
- Assisting customers with product queries and location support
- Handling stock rotation using FIFO principles
- Supporting cashiers with point-of-sale transactions when required
- Maintaining clean and organised storerooms and shelves
Customer Service and Sales Support Duties
Customer service is a key part of this role. You are expected to assist shoppers in finding products and resolving basic queries quickly. You also support sales by ensuring that products are available, visible, and correctly displayed. Communication skills and product knowledge are important for helping customers make informed choices.
You may also assist at the till point depending on store needs. This includes processing payments, handling loyalty cards, and ensuring accurate transactions. Accuracy is critical when dealing with cash and electronic payments.
Key customer service responsibilities include:
- Assisting customers with product location and information
- Handling queries and escalating issues when needed
- Supporting checkout processes when required
- Promoting a positive and professional customer experience
Stock Control and Merchandising Duties
A major part of this role involves stock control and merchandising. You are responsible for ensuring shelves are fully stocked and visually organised. Products must be rotated regularly to prevent expired stock from being sold. Stock accuracy is essential to maintain store efficiency and customer satisfaction.
You also support receiving stock deliveries and ensuring items are stored correctly in the backroom. Proper handling of goods reduces loss and improves inventory control.
Typical stock-related tasks include:
- Receiving and unpacking stock deliveries
- Ensuring correct storage of merchandise
- Rotating stock using FIFO principles
- Reporting damaged or expired products
- Assisting with stock counts and inventory checks
- Maintaining clean and organised storerooms
Skills and Competencies Required
This role requires a combination of basic retail knowledge, physical ability, and customer service skills. Training is provided, but candidates must be willing to learn and follow procedures accurately. Attention to detail and responsibility are important for success.
Essential competencies include:
- Basic numeracy for handling transactions and stock counts
- Ability to follow instructions and store procedures
- Strong communication skills in English
- Ability to work under supervision
- Time management and task completion
- Physical ability to lift and move stock
Advantageous skills include:
- Basic computer literacy (Word, Excel, Outlook)
- Familiarity with retail systems such as SAP
- Previous retail or FMCG experience
Work Environment and Expectations
This position is based in a busy retail pharmacy environment. The store operates during extended retail hours, which requires flexibility. You may work weekends, public holidays, and shifts depending on operational needs. The role involves standing for long periods and performing physically active tasks such as lifting and unpacking stock.
Dis-Chem maintains strict standards for hygiene, safety, and customer service. Employees must follow all policies and procedures, including uniform and personal appearance standards. Accuracy, discipline, and reliability are expected at all times.
